Direct comparison of every spec from each device profile.
| Specification | POTV Lobo | XMAX Starry V3 |
|---|---|---|
| Price (USD) | $160 | $100 |
| Device Type | Portable | Portable |
| Heating Type | Dynamic Hybrid | Conduction |
| Heat Up Time | ~40 seconds | ~30 seconds |
| Temperature Range | 160-221°C (320-430°F) | 212°F - 464°F |
| Chamber Capacity | 0.2g | 0.3g |
| Battery Type | Samsung 35E 3500mAh 8A (replaceable flat-top 18650) | 18650 |
| Battery Capacity | — | 2900mAh |
| Battery Life | Up to ~10 sessions per charge | 60-80 minutes |
| Charging | USB-C | Micro USB |
| Charge Time | — | 90-120 minutes |
| Pass-Through Charging | — | Yes |
| Dimensions | 8.89cm H without stem, 10.16cm H with dimpled stem, 5.4cm W, 2.85cm D | 11 x 3.5 x 2.4 cm |
| Weight | 150g without stem, 156g with dimpled stem | 120g |
| Power Adjustment | Digital (LCD) | Digital (precise) |
| Chamber Material | Titanium | Ceramic |
| Concentrate Support | Supported with included concentrate pad in the dosing capsule (use very small amounts) | — |
| Brand | Planet of the Vapes | XMAX |
| Adjustable Airflow | — | No |
| Country of Manufacture | — | China |
| Display Type | — | OLED |
| Haptic Feedback | — | Yes |
| Manufacturer | — | TopGreen Technology Co |
| Release Date | 2023 | 2019 |
| Replaceable Battery | — | Yes |
| Session Style | Session | Session |
| Warranty | 2 years through POTV | 1 year |
The biggest practical difference is heating approach: POTV Lobo runs dynamic hybrid while XMAX Starry V3 runs conduction. That changes flavor delivery, vapor density, and how the device responds to slow versus fast draws.
XMAX Starry V3 is the cheaper option at $100 compared with $160 for the POTV Lobo, about $60 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.
XMAX Starry V3 reaches session-ready temperature in ~30 seconds, while the POTV Lobo takes ~40 seconds. That's roughly 10 seconds quicker on the XMAX Starry V3, which is useful if you want shorter, on-demand sessions.
POTV Lobo uses dynamic hybrid heating, while the XMAX Starry V3 uses conduction.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.
XMAX Starry V3 has the larger chamber at 0.3g, versus 0.2g on the POTV Lobo. A bigger bowl means fewer reloads on long sessions; a smaller one suits microdosing and quicker bowls.
XMAX Starry V3 is the lighter unit at 120g, around 30g less than the POTV Lobo at 150g without stem, 156g with dimpled stem. The lighter device is easier to carry and pocket day-to-day.
